Why Invest in a Dedicated Auto Vacuum Cleaner?

You may be wondering if your regular family vacuum cleaner can't get the job done. While technically possible, utilizing a standard vacuum for your automobile provides numerous drawbacks. Auto vacuum provide unique advantages:

  • Portability and Compactness: Designed with car interiors in mind, auto vacuums are significantly smaller and lighter than household designs. This makes navigating around seats, under control panels, and in the trunk a lot easier.
  • Power Source Convenience: Many auto vacuums are powered directly from your automobile's 12V cigarette lighter socket, removing the need for extension cables and permitting cleaning anywhere, anytime. Cordless choices provide even higher liberty.
  • Specialized Attachments: Auto vacuum frequently feature a range of accessories specifically created for car cleaning. These may include crevice tools for reaching narrow gaps, brush nozzles for upholstery and carpets, and versatile hose pipes for prolonged reach.
  • Optimized Suction Power: While not constantly as effective as sturdy household vacuums, auto vacuums are engineered with adequate suction to effectively take on common car dirt like crumbs, dust, pet hair, and small debris. They are optimized for the kinds of messes discovered in vehicles.
  • Reduce of Storage: Their compact size makes keeping auto vacuums in your car's trunk, glove compartment, or under a seat hassle-free, guaranteeing they are constantly readily available for fast cleanups.

Purchasing a dedicated auto vacuum cleaner is about efficiency and convenience. It's about having the right tool for the job, making car cleaning less of a chore and more of a quick and easy maintenance task.

Checking Out the Different Types of Auto Vacuum Cleaners

The auto vacuum market offers a range of types, each with its own strengths and weaknesses. Comprehending these classifications will help you limit your options based on your particular requirements and preferences.

  • Corded Auto Vacuum Cleaners: These vacuums plug directly into your cars and truck's 12V cigarette lighter socket.
  • Pros: Consistent power supply as long as your automobile is running, generally more cost effective, typically provide stronger suction compared to likewise priced cordless designs.
  • Cons: Limited by cord length, requiring you to handle the cord throughout cleaning, connected to the cars and truck's power source.
  • Cordless Auto Vacuum Cleaners: Powered by rechargeable batteries, providing maximum portability.
  • Pros: Unrestricted motion, no cables to tangle, can be used anywhere, not simply in the automobile.
  • Cons: Limited runtime depending on battery capacity, suction power might be somewhat less than corded models at comparable cost points, require routine charging.
  • Portable Auto Vacuum Cleaners: A more comprehensive category incorporating both corded and cordless options. These are created to be lightweight and quickly maneuverable for spot cleaning and smaller sized locations. Many auto vacuums fall into this classification.
  • Wet/Dry Auto Vacuum Cleaners: These versatile vacuums can handle both dry particles and liquid spills, making them perfect for families with children or pet owners who frequently come across messes of all kinds.
  • Pros: Clean up spills and dry messes, included flexibility for different types of cars and truck cleaning needs.
  • Cons: May be slightly bulkier than dry-only models, can be more expensive.

Key Features to Consider When Choosing an Auto Vacuum Cleaner

Selecting the very best auto vacuum includes thinking about a number of factors to ensure it satisfies your specific cleaning requirements and preferences. Here are some crucial features to evaluate:

  • Suction Power: Measured in Air Watts (AW) or kPa (kilopascals), suction power figures out how successfully the vacuum can lift dirt and particles. Higher suction power normally translates to better cleaning, especially for embedded dirt and pet hair.
  • Source of power & & Battery Life (for Cordless): For corded designs, cord length is crucial for reaching all areas of your automobile. For cordless designs, consider the battery runtime and charging time. Try to find models with sufficient battery life to clean your whole cars and truck interior on a single charge.
  • Accessories: The included accessories significantly affect the vacuum's versatility. Necessary accessories consist of:
  • Crevice Tool: For tight areas in between seats and along control panels.
  • Brush Nozzle: For upholstery, carpets, and floor mats.
  • Extension Hose: For reaching under seats and into the trunk.
  • Upholstery Tool: Specifically designed for material seats and interiors.
  • Mobility and Weight: A lightweight and ergonomically developed vacuum will be simpler to maneuver and less tiring to utilize, specifically for longer cleaning sessions.
  • Dustbin Capacity: The size of the dustbin determines how typically you need to empty it. A larger capability is hassle-free for less regular emptying, however can likewise make the vacuum bulkier. Consider a balance between capability and mobility.
  • Filter Type: HEPA filters are extremely advised as they trap fine dust particles and allergens, contributing to a healthier vehicle environment, especially for allergic reaction sufferers.
  • Noise Level: Vacuum cleaners can be loud. If noise is a concern, look for models that promote a lower decibel ranking.
  • Durability and Build Quality: A sturdy vacuum will last longer and endure regular usage. Look for reviews regarding the item's sturdiness and material quality.
  • Rate: Auto vacuum cleaners vary in price from economical to premium designs. Identify your spending plan and balance functions with rate to find the best worth.

Tips for Effective Auto Vacuuming

To optimize the efficiency of your auto vacuum cleaner, consider these tips:

  • Start from Top to Bottom: Begin cleaning from the control panel and upper surfaces, working your way down to the floor mats and carpets. This avoids dirt from falling onto currently cleaned up areas.
  • Use the Right Attachments: Utilize the crevice tool for tight areas, the brush nozzle for upholstery, and the extension pipe for hard-to-reach locations.
  • Pre-Clean Heavily Soiled Areas: For greatly stained areas, think about utilizing a stiff brush to loosen up dirt and particles before vacuuming.
  • Tidy Filters Regularly: A stopped up filter reduces suction power. Tidy or replace filters as recommended by the manufacturer.
  • Empty Dustbin Frequently: Empty the dustbin when it's nearing full to preserve optimum suction.
  • Don't Forget the Trunk: The trunk frequently builds up a substantial quantity of dirt and particles. Provide it the exact same attention as the remainder of the vehicle interior.
  • Vacuum Regularly: Regular vacuuming, even quick touch-ups, prevents dirt buildup and makes deep cleaning much easier.

Preserving Your Auto Vacuum Cleaner

Appropriate upkeep ensures your auto vacuum performs efficiently and lasts longer. Follow these simple actions:

  • Clean or Replace Filters: Regularly tidy washable filters or replace non reusable filters according to the producer's guidelines.
  • Empty Dustbin After Each Use: This avoids blockages and keeps suction power.
  • Look for Blockages: Periodically inspect the hose pipe and nozzles for any clogs and clear them.
  • Shop Properly: Store your vacuum in a clean, dry place, preferably in its bring bag or a designated storage space in your vehicle.
  • Charge Cordless Models Regularly: For cordless designs, keep the battery charged according to the manufacturer's suggestions to prolong battery life.
